Clinical Observation of Electroacupuncture on Temporal Three-Needle Acupoints for the Treatment of Post-stroke Depression

Benguo Wang

Open publisher page 1 citations

Abstract

Objective:To observe the therapeutic effect of electroacupuncture on temporal three - needle acupoints for post - stroke depression(PSD).Methods:Sixty mild - and middle-degree PSD patients were randomized into 2 groups:group A received electroacupuncture on temporal three - needle acupoints and oral use of fluoxetine hydrochloride capsules,and group B received oral use of fluoxetine hydrochloride capsules.The scores of Hamilton Rating Scale for Depression (HRSD),Self-Rating Depression Scale(SDS),and functional independence measure(FIM) were evaluated in both group before and after treatment.Results:After treatment,HRSD and SDS scores were decreased in both group,and the difference being significant in group A after treatment for 2 weeks and in group B after treatment for 3 weeks(P0.05).The differences of HRSD and SDS scores were significant between the two groups after treatment for 2 weeks(P0.05).After treatment for 4 weeks,FIM score was increased in both groups(P0.01 compared that before treatment),and the increase was obvious in group A(P0.01).Conclusion:Electroacupuncture on temporal three - needle acupoints combining with oral use of fluoxetine hydrochloride capsules can relieve the depression in post - stroke depression patients,and improve their activities of daily life.
